Released January 18th, 2001, 'Stickmen' stars Robbie Magasiva, Paolo Rotondo, Scott Wills, Simone Kessell The R movie has a runtime of about 1 hr 38 min, and received a user score of 56 (out of 100) on TMDb, which put together reviews from 14 experienced users.
You probably already know what the movie's about, but just in case... Here's the plot: "Jack, Thomas and Wayne are the Stickmen. They like nothing more than having a beer in one hand, a pool cue in the other, a coin on the table and a sexy bird or two. They play pub pool for fun and money at Dave's bar. Desperate to get out of debt, Dave gets the Stickmen entered into a high stakes pool tournament run by vicious crime boss "Daddy". He also gets them into a whole rack of trouble." .
